@NycVixen  Please do research before getting a rabbit.  I owned rabbits most of my life, rescued all of them.  They nibble on most anything, electric wires, furniture, and a male if not nuetered, will mark you and anything else.  There is a lot of information to learn about rabbits, and it will make for a happier life for you and the rabbit when you are informed.
